UBISOFT: Trackmania is coming to consoles

Ubisoft’s intense time trial racing series is finally making the leap to console. Reborn as Trackmania Turbo, the super-quick game is built around completing laps as fast as possible, competing against many other cars at once. 200 tracks are confirmed to be in the console edition of the title, spread …

UBISOFT: Rainbow Six Siege beta coming this September

Ubisoft has announced that the beta for its upcoming Rainbow Six Siege will be available this September. On September 24th, gamers on all available platforms will be able to try their hand at the tactical shooter. Ubisoft also showed off its Terrohunt multiplayer mode live on stage – complete with …

UBISOFT: New IP For Honor to reinvent sword fighting games

Assassin’s Creed developer Ubisoft Montreal is putting together another new IP for new generation consoles. The game is in a new genre for the publisher, a action-packed sword-fighting combat game featuring Vikings vs Knights vs Samurai. So it’s not a historical project. It is a four vs four multiplayer experience …

UBISOFT: Just Dance 2016 adds world’s first ‘dance on demand’ subscription service

Just Dance is now the biggest music video game franchise of all time. That’s according to publisher Ubisoft, who once again brought the dancing rhythm game to its E3 press conference. This year’s instalment, Just Dance 2016, was confirmed to be heading to ‘all motion platforms’. This includes smartphones, which …
